ის 2012 Global Farmer Roundtable marked the seventh meeting of what has grown to be an exciting and dynamic annual event. This year fifteen farmers from thirteen nations met to discuss a number of issues from a variety of viewpoints on October 15 დრ16 in Des Moines, áƒáƒ˜áƒáƒ•áƒáƒ¡. The moderator was Dr. Nicholas Kalaitzandonakes from the University of Missouri.
The Global Farmer Roundtable was held again during the week of The World Food Prize Symposium (áƒáƒ¥áƒ¢áƒáƒ›áƒ‘ერი 17-19) which allowed the farmers attending the Roundtable to also take part in the Borlaug Dialogue, Laureate Award Ceremony, and other side events held during the week. Several of the farmers were also invited to participate on panels in the Symposium or side events during the week.
Rajesh Kumar from India received the 2012 Kleckner Trade & Technology Advancement Award on Tuesday, áƒáƒ¥áƒ¢áƒáƒ›áƒ‘ერი 16 at a Global Farmer Awards Dinner hosted by Truth About Trade & Technology and CropLife International.
Kumar farms fifty-five acres in southern India, using irrigation to grow sweetcorn, tomatoes, brinjal (მáƒáƒ— შáƒáƒ ის გმრსიმინდი ჩემს სáƒáƒ™áƒ£áƒ—áƒáƒ ფერმáƒáƒ¨áƒ˜ ფილიპინებში) and other vegetables. In addition to the sweet corn processing plant, he sells fresh produce directly to consumers through kiosks at several locations.
He believes that agriculture can be revived and thrive in India, but biotechnology must be embraced by farmers and the farmers must organize and demand that the government allow them their rights to use this important tool.
“India has a desperate need for agricultural biotechnology. It is for our overall self-development that tools like biotechnology must be available so farmers can produce enough food for our people. We must participate in the Gene Revolution.”
ის Kleckner Trade & Technology Advancement Award was established in 2007 in honor of Dean Kleckner, სიმáƒáƒ თლე ვáƒáƒáƒ áƒáƒ‘ის შესáƒáƒ®áƒ”ბ & Technology Chairman Emeritus. The award is given annually in conjunction with the TATT Global Farmer Roundtable. The award recipients are Rosalie Ellasus, ფილიპინები (2007); Jeff Bidstrup, áƒáƒ•áƒ¡áƒ¢áƒ áƒáƒšáƒ˜áƒ (2008); Jim McCarthy, Ireland (2009), Gabriela Cruz, პáƒáƒ ტუგáƒáƒšáƒ˜áƒ (2010), გილბერტი áƒáƒ áƒáƒž ბáƒáƒ ს, კენირ(2011), and now Rajesh Kumar, ინდáƒáƒ”თი (2012).
